These three no prep, printable emotions dice are an easy way to show our elementary and primary students how to identify our emotions and express them to help them build an emotional vocabulary. The dice also demonstrate to students that everyone feels negative emotions and what this feels like. Not only that but understand what these feelings feel like and what we can do when we feel these emotions. This fun dice activity is a great way to start the conversations about emotions with our young people. Both dice incorporate a mixture of positive and negative emotions for students to think about and identity. To play, you’ll use only one of the two emotion words dice. Simply roll the emotion words dice and the one with the prompts. Then answer the prompt you rolled using whatever emotion was rolled on the other die. So for example, if you roll “Name one thing you can say when you feel this emotion” and “tired,” then you could answer the prompt by saying, “I’m so tired!” or “I’m exhausted!” All pages of this resource are available in both full colour or black and white to suit your printing requirements. Using the correct pronouns for a person is a way of respecting that person’s gender identity and forming an inclusive environment. Teaching about gender and gender-neutral pronouns is important because all people deserve respect and to work, learn, and ultimately live in a safe and inclusive environment!
